[CBS 8:00] The Ed Sullivan Show [Reg]
Season 22, episode 17

With Muhammad Ali, Bill Dana, The Kessler Twins, Buddy Greco, Minnie Pearl.
Ali performs excerpts from his 1969 Broadway play "Buck White" ("Big Time Buck White Chant" and "We Came in Chains"); June Allyson sings a medley of show tunes; Michael James Brody and his wife Renee DuBois duet "You Ain't Goin' Nowhere". Bill Dana portrays his character Jose Jimenez as a skydiver.

[CBS 9:00] The Glen Campbell Goodtime Hour [Reg]
Season 2, episode 16

With Peggy Lee, Wally Cox, Neil Diamond, Patchett and Tarses.
Campbell opens with "Sunny", then joins Cox for a demonstration of classical whistling and yodeling; Miss Lee solos "Something" and duets with Glen on "Leaving on a Jet Plane"; Diamond sings "Brooklyn Roads"; Campbell and Cox present excerpts from a spoof of motorcycle films; Campbell, Miss Lee and Diamond offer a rock medley.
